The Crown is adding to its cast.

When the Netflix series returns for its fifth season, it will cover one of the most shocking events that the royal family has had to endure—the death of Diana, Princess of Wales.

The car that Diana was traveling in was fleeing from the paparazzi when it crashed on August 31, 1997. The People’s Princess, as she was affectionately known, was only 36 at the time. The other passengers in the vehicle—including her companion Dodi Fayed—also died.  

Producers of The Crown have now cast The Kite Runner star, Khalid Abdalla, as Fayed, while Elizabeth Debicki who most recently starred in Tenet will take over from Emma Corrin as Diana. 

The rest of the cast has also been updated for the final two seasons, with Imelda Staunton starring as Queen Elizabeth II and Dominic West as Prince Charles.

Netflix has yet to announce when season 5 of The Crown will be released.
